Overview

Wickwood Inn Saugatuck is a great place to stay in a shopping district, a 10-minute drive from the wee Douglas Beach. Wi-Fi is accessible throughout the property and a private parking garage is provided on site.

Location

This inn is located a mere 5 minutes' walk from James Brandess Studios & Gallery and is within 25 minutes' walk of Saugatuck Dune Rides. Good Goods Gallery is a short distance from the 4-star hotel, and Ridge Cider Co. Tasting Room is approximately 5 minutes away by car. The accommodation allows you to enjoy such natural sights as Kalamazoo Lake just 8 minutes' walk away. Cultural experiences in the area feature Saugatuck-Douglas Historical Museum, situated only 0.8 km from Wickwood Inn.

Rooms

Certain rooms have a stone fireplace along with a sofa for guests' convenience. They have a comfortable interior. The private bathrooms are appointed with a shower, and such comforts as free toiletries and dressing gowns.

Eat & Drink

Serving American specialities, Borrowed Time is nearly 5 minutes' walk away.

Leisure & Business

This Saugatuck hotel provides a sunbathing terrace and a picnic area for an extra charge. If you like an active lifestyle, hiking, horseback riding, and skiing are available on site.
